Position Overview

The Construction Superintendent will be responsible for supervising all on-site road construction activities, ensuring projects are completed safely and on time. This role includes managing crews, coordinating with subcontractors and suppliers, and communicating with project managers.

Key Responsibilities

Supervise daily job site operations, ensuring work is performed to project specifications and safety standards

Lead and coordinate field crew, subcontractors, and equipment operators

Monitor project schedules, progress, and materials

Work closely with project managers and estimators to align field work with project plans

Resolve field issues promptly and professionally

Ensure accurate documentation of daily reports, timekeeping, and materials usage

Enforce safety policies and conduct job site safety inspections

Qualifications

5+ years of experience in highway construction (TxDOT projects a plus)

3+ years of experience in a supervisory or superintendent role

Strong knowledge of road construction methods, materials, and equipment

Ability to read and interpret construction plans, drawings, specifications, and schedules

Proven leadership and team management skills

Excellent communication and problem-solving abilities

Proficient in job site documentation and basic computer skills

Valid driver’s license (required)
